The gust factor curve proposed by durst in 1960 is widely used within the wind engineering community to convert gust wind speeds to different averaging periods, or to estimate peak gust wind speeds from a longer term mean wind speed. Asce 7 05 provides two methods for wind load calculation. The simplified procedure is for building with simple diaphragm, roof slope less than 10 degree, mean roof height less than 30 ft, regular shape rigid building, no expansion joints, flat terrain and not subjected to special wind condition. In the united states, the wind speed used in design is often referred to as a 3second gust which is the highest sustained gust over a 3second period having a probability of being exceeded per year of 1 in 50 asce 705.
